2003 Caterham 7 vs. 2001 Ford Ranger
To start off, 2003 Caterham 7 is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Ford Ranger.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Ford Ranger would be higher. At 2,300 cc (4 cylinders), 2001 Ford Ranger is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2003 Caterham 7 (160 HP @ 7500 RPM) has 32 more horse power than 2001 Ford Ranger. (128 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2003 Caterham 7 should accelerate faster than 2001 Ford Ranger.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2001 Ford Ranger weights approximately 1220 kg more than 2003 Caterham 7.
Because 2001 Ford Ranger is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2003 Caterham 7.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2001 Ford Ranger will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2001 Ford Ranger (203 Nm) has 27 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 Caterham 7. (176 Nm). This means 2001 Ford Ranger will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 Caterham 7.
